Ubuntu下Awk的文本转换与编码

发布时间:2024-08-18 11:29:26 作者:小樊
来源:亿速云 阅读:87

在Ubuntu下,可以使用Awk来进行文本转换和编码操作。Awk是一种强大的文本处理工具,可以用于快速处理文本文件的内容。

以下是一些常见的Awk命令示例:

  1. 将文本文件按列分割并输出到新文件:
awk '{print $1, $2}' input.txt > output.txt

这个命令将input.txt文件中的每一行按照空格分割成多个列,并将第一列和第二列的内容输出到output.txt文件中。

  1. 将文本文件进行编码转换:
iconv -f utf-8 -t gbk input.txt > output.txt

这个命令将input.txt文件的编码从utf-8转换为gbk,并将结果输出到output.txt文件中。

  1. 使用Awk进行文本替换操作:
awk '{gsub("old_string", "new_string"); print}' input.txt > output.txt

这个命令将input.txt文件中的所有old_string替换为new_string,并将结果输出到output.txt文件中。

通过这些Awk命令示例,你可以在Ubuntu下方便地进行文本转换和编码操作。

推荐阅读:
  1. ubuntu如何修改hosts文件
  2. ubuntu安装实例分析

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

ubuntu

上一篇:Ubuntu上Awk的复杂文本结构解析

下一篇:OpenCV C++版图像颜色校正实践

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》